Question 3 Not yet answered Marked out of 1.00000 P Flag question You have an unknown compound. It yields a positive permanganate test, a negative bromine test, a positive iodoform test, a postive, but slow (5 minutes) Lucas test. Which of the following answers is fully consistent with these results Select one: O a. aldehyde b. alkene O c. a secondary alcohol with the structure R-CH(OH)-CH2-CH R is a saturated hydrocarbon substituent. O d. a secondary alcohol with the structure R-CH(OH)-CH3 Ris a saturated hydrocarbon substituent. O e. alkyl halide O O f. a tertiary alcohol g. alkyne h. a primary alcohol Previous page Finish attempt. Solution d) will give positive permanganate test,negative bromine test,a positive iodoform test and slow lucas test. d) a secondary alcohol with the structure R-CH(OH)CH 3 R is a saturated hydrocarbon is fully consistent with all the results. also secondary alcohol gives slow lucas test, positive permanganate test and negative bromine test. a secondary alcohol with the structure R-CH(OH)CH 3 with adjacent alkyl group (CH 3 ) gives positive iodoform test . Therefore, not true for R-CH(OH)CH 2 CH 3 types of groups. positive permanganate and bromine test is for alkene and alkyne systems. So negative bromine test for alkenes does not hold true. Primary alcohol show immediate lucas test so primary alcohol also rules out. Tertiary alcohol show turbidity on heating for lucas test so this option also rules out aldehyde only ethanal gives positive iodoform test.not true for all the aldehydes. .
